You can do Pokhara – Kande – Tolka – Landrung – Ghandrung – Tadapani – Ghorepani – Tirkedhunga – Pokhara in five days. There are good lodges and facilities all through. You can hire a guide and porters as needed from Pokhara. You need a ACAP permit and TIMS permit which you can get in Pokhara before your trek.
